I love how the lightweight texture spreads smoothly when applied with hands. Even when used on arms or legs, it absorbs nicely without feeling too sticky. I apply it after my skincare routine and before makeup, and with just a light application, it doesn't cause my foundation to pill. Although it's a white cream, there's no white cast, so it's convenient as I don't need to do any additional complexion correction. I've been using it for about a week and haven't experienced any blemishes.
ConsI've heard you should apply sunscreen in an amount equal to a 500 won coin, and while I don't use quite that much, I do try to apply generously. However, with this product, a generous application leads to white clumping... So I end up applying just a little, which makes me feel like I'm not getting enough sun protection. Also, if you apply too much, it can look oily, especially in the T-zone and around the nose, making it appear like excess oil is flowing. This happens even though I have dry skin with severe atopic dermatitis...
TipIt's best to apply it in small amounts, making sure it doesn't clump or get caught in areas like the sides of the nose, around the jawline, or where there are baby hairs!

The best thing about this sunscreen is its excellent ingredients. It's really hard to find a sunscreen with good ingredients, but this one doesn't contain any potentially harmful components. I've used it for about 6 days and haven't experienced any blemishes. (My skin usually reacts quickly when I change products, but this sunscreen seems to suit my skin well!) Despite being a mineral sunscreen, I was surprised that it didn't leave a white cast. I have a darker complexion (I'm a full 22 in Korean foundation shades), but the white cast isn't noticeable. It does slightly brighten the skin, but it's more of a subtle skin tone correction rather than the effect you'd get from a brightening moisturizer. I really like this! If you're not a fan of white cast but want a mineral sunscreen, this one might be perfect for you.
ConsAs someone with oily skin, I prefer sunscreens that leave a matte finish. However, as you can see in the photo, this sunscreen leaves a shiny finish. Even after applying powder and makeup, I noticed my skin became oily faster than usual. It's not excessively greasy, but when you touch your skin after applying the sunscreen, it feels slightly tacky. Your opinion on this might vary depending on your preferred skin finish (those who like a dewy look might enjoy it). I also believe it's crucial to apply the correct amount of sunscreen (about two finger-lengths for the entire face, right? I'm as worried about skin cancer as I am about skin irritation). On the first day, when I applied the full amount at once, the sunscreen started to pill. This might be due to my oily skin. From the next day, I started applying half the amount, waiting a bit, then applying the other half. This definitely reduced the pilling, but it might be a bit of a hassle every morning!
